RANGELEY — On Friday evening, Oct. 11, memorial visitation for Sheila Haley was held at The Barn, the welcoming vestry of the Rangeley Congregational Church. A public memorial service celebrating Sheila’s life followed on Saturday, Oct. 12, at 11 a.m. from the Rangeley Congregational Church with the Rev. Cathie Wallace officiating. Sue Downes-Borko was the pianist and longtime friend, Jean Stewart, gave a personal eulogy and offered the reading “Do Not Stand at My Grave and Weep.” Congregation hymns included “Amazing Grace” and “In The Garden.” The readings were Psalm 122 and 1 Corinthians 13. The postlude was the “Yellow Rose of Texas.” Following services, a comfort reception was held at the Kemankeag Masonic Lodge on Richardson Avenue in Rangeley. Arrangements were in the care of the Wiles Remembrance Center and Funeral Home of Farmington.
